2017-06-16 14 views
0

私はキューからメッセージを消費していますが、何らかの処理を行った後、メッセージを別のサービスにルーティングする必要があります。オブジェクトタイプに基づくフィルタリング

キュー - >サービス(アクティベータ) - >ルータ

現在、私は、サービスの活性化因子とペイロードベースのルータを含むチェーンを使用しています。問題は、ルータがチャネルにのみ送信することができますが、私はそれが別のサービスに行くことです。

+1

私は質問を理解していない - 単純に次のサービスアクティベータを購読ルータの出力チャネルに出力されます。 –

答えて

0

お客様の要件を正しく理解している場合は、service-activatorの後にrouterの代わりにpublish-subscribe-channelを使用する必要があります。

キュー - >サービス - ベーター - >パブリッシュ・サブスクライブ・チャネル - >あなたのサービス

例ここにある:publish-subscribe-channel example

関連する問題